The Structural Analysis Satisfaction Survey is a vital feedback tool designed specifically for engineering firms that provide structural analysis services. By gathering insights directly from clients, this survey assesses their satisfaction levels and highlights areas for improvement. Understanding client feedback is crucial for any business, as it not only helps enhance service quality but also fosters stronger client relationships. By actively seeking input, firms can ensure they meet client expectations, adapt to changing needs, and ultimately drive business growth through continuous improvement in their structural analysis offerings.


This survey fits seamlessly into the project lifecycle, ideally being distributed upon project completion or during key project milestones. Sharing the Structural Analysis Satisfaction Survey with clients can be done easily via email or through a dedicated client portal, ensuring that feedback is collected in a timely manner. By making this survey accessible, engineering firms can quickly gather valuable insights, which can then be analyzed to refine processes and elevate service standards, ultimately leading to enhanced client satisfaction and loyalty.

What should be included in a structural analysis satisfaction survey?
chevron down icon
A structural analysis satisfaction survey should include fields for overall satisfaction (star_rating), service quality (star_rating), communication (star_rating), open-ended questions about what worked well and what could be improved, multiple-choice areas of satisfaction, and a single-choice question on whether the client would recommend us.
